Steward_Xu

  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

2017年4月17日

摘要: 一、说明在现实环境中可能需要批量部署服务器,那么在我们已经部署好一台服务以后如果实现剩下的服务批量安装呢: 使用shell能否实现功能: 假设我们要部署lamp或者是lnmp如何实现脚本部署? 使用以下代码可实现: 部署方法1: 1 #!/bin/sh 2 menu ( ){ 3 4 cat<<EN 阅读全文
posted @ 2017-04-17 15:03 Steward_Xu 阅读(759) 评论(0) 推荐(0) 编辑

摘要: 一、文件测试操作符: 在书写测试表达式是,可以使用一下的文件测试操作符。 更多的参数可以help test或者man bash 二、字符串测试操作符: 字符串测试操作符的作用:比较两个字符串是否相同、字符长度是否为0,字符串是否为null(注:bash区分长度字符串和空字符串) “=”比较两个字符串 阅读全文
posted @ 2017-04-17 13:54 Steward_Xu 阅读(464) 评论(0) 推荐(0) 编辑

摘要: 一、shell脚本建立: shell脚本通常是在编辑器(如vi/vim)中编写,也可以在命令行中直接执行; 1、脚本开头: 规范的脚本第一行需要指出有哪个程序(解释器)来执行脚本中的内容,在Linux中一般为: #!/bin/sh 或者 #!/bin/bash “#!”,在执行脚本时,内核会根据“# 阅读全文
posted @ 2017-04-17 13:33 Steward_Xu 阅读(518) 评论(0) 推荐(0) 编辑